Financial Oversight: Manage and supervise all financial transactions, ensuring accuracy and adherence to accounting principles.
Financial Reporting: Prepare and present financial statements, including bal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ow reports, to senior management.
Budgeting and Forecasting: Develop annual budgets and financial forecasts, monitoring performance against these benchmarks.
Tax Compliance: Ensure timely and accurate filing of tax returns and compliance with all tax regulations.
Audit Coordination: Liaise with internal and external auditors, facilitating audits and implementing recommendations.
Team Leadership: Supervise and mentor accounting staff, assigning tasks and evaluating performance.
Policy Development: Establish and maintain accounting policies and procedures to ensure efficient financial operations.
Educational Background: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field; a Chartered Accountant (CA) qualification is often preferred.
Experience: Minimum of 5 years in accounting or finance roles, with at least 2 years in a supervisory position.
Technical Proficiency: Strong knowledge of accounting software (e.g., Tally, SAP) and Microsoft Excel.
Analytical Skills: Ability to analyze complex financial data and provide strategic insights.
Communication Skills: Excellent verbal and written communication abilities for effective collaboration and reporting.
